HotelsClick.com

Hotel Red Mangrove Aventura Lodge All Inclusive Adventure - Galapagos Islands Ecuador - Photos

» Hotel Red Mangrove Aventura Lodge All Inclusive Adventure - Galapagos Islands Ecuador

Booking.com

No photos

Hotel Red Mangrove Aventura Lodge All Inclusive Adventure - Galapagos Islands Ecuador - Search and Book Hotel

Ave. Charles Darwin S/n Y Piquero Galapagos Islands
Hotels 3 Stars Ecuador